Description Oleg Titov 2000-11-29 16:58:35 UTC
gtcd player is unable to handle multiple CDDB responces (when there are
many records corresponding to same diskID). In many cases gtcd selects not
so good information from server

Comment 1 Havoc Pennington 2000-11-29 17:36:12 UTC
Does gtcd crash or just randomly choose one of the responses? Should it ask the
user to choose a response or try to pick the best one itself?

Comment 2 Oleg Titov 2000-11-29 18:06:35 UTC
gtcd just randomly choose one of the responses.
I feel it should ask the user to choose a response.
